Summary of the comparison

Carlton Miniott Primary Academy and Alanbrooke Academy are primary schools in Thirsk.

  • Carlton Miniott Primary Academy scores 65 out of 100 (grade C, average) and Alanbrooke Academy scores 77 out of 100 (grade B, strong). Alanbrooke Academy is ahead on our composite score.

  • Carlton Miniott Primary Academy was judged Good and Alanbrooke Academy was judged exceptional.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has risen at Carlton Miniott Primary Academy (63.0% in 2022-23, 71.0% in 2024-25).
